This is my third term as a member or the House Ways and Means Committee (‘budget committee) and like last year, it’s going to be very challenging times. Fortunately, the House did not go along with the Senate’s wish for a new budget and instead we stuck with the same level of spending from the prior year (passing a Continuing Resolution). Had we not done that, we would start with making draconian cuts to what was proposed.

Here are the dates for hopefully passing a budget through the House in time for the Senate to address.

House Ways and Means Committee
2021 Budget Schedule:*

January 12 – 14: First week of session & budget subcommittee meetings
January 19 – 21: Budget subcommittee meetings
January 26 – 28: Budget subcommittee meetings
February 2 – 4: Budget subcommittee meetings
February 9 – 11: Proviso Subcommittee meeting
February 16 – 18:** FULL COMMITTEE BUDGET DELIBERATIONS

February 23 – 25: Appropriation bill printed
March 2 – 4: Printed appropriation bills placed on House members’ desks

March 8 – 12:** HOUSE FLOOR BUDGET DELIBERATIONS

Important Dates:
January 31, 2020: Deadline for proviso submittals
February 15, 2020: BEA estimate due
* Schedule subject to change at the discretion of the chairman.
** Full committee and House floor deliberations may begin on the Monday of the weeks indicated.
